Key Takeaways Consumer sentiment improved to 74.0 in the preliminary December reading of the Michigan Consumer Sentiment Index, up from last month and better than economist projections. Sentiment on current economic conditions were higher, but inflation expectations also moved higher, while consumer economic expectations moved lower. The states with the cheapest 30-year mortgage refinance rates Thursday were New York, Delaware, California, Arizona, Louisiana, Mississippi, and South Dakota. The seven states registered 30-year refi averages between 6.47% and 6.80%.
